Latex-Based Membrane for Oily Wastewater Filtration: Study on the Sulfur Concentration Effect

Khaled Abuhasel et al.

Summary: Nitrile butadiene rubber (NBR) latex/graphene oxide (GO) membranes were fabricated using a new method involving latex compounding and curing. This study evaluated the effect of sulfur loading on the morphology, crosslink density, tensile properties, permeation flux, and oil rejection rate performance of the membranes. Results showed that sulfur loading significantly influenced the surface morphology, integrity, strength, water flux, and oil rejection rate of the membranes, with 1.0 phr sulfur showing the highest water flux value and oil rejection rate.

Synthesis of tungsten oxide/ amino-functionalized sugarcane bagasse derived-carbon quantum dots (WO3/N-CQDs) composites for methylene blue removal

Muhammad Wahyu Nugraha et al.

Summary: In this study, a tungsten oxide/amino-functionalized sugarcane bagasse derived-carbon quantum dots (WO3/N-CQDs) composite was successfully prepared through a simple mixing process, exhibiting enhanced adsorption and photocatalytic degradation performance compared to pristine WO3. The WO3/N-CQDs EDA 2.5% composite showed the best performance in terms of MB removal efficiency, removal rate constant, and COD removal efficiency, with good stability after three degradation cycles. The combination of N-CQDs and WO3 resulted in improved photodegradation, showing significant potential for wastewater treatment.
